
Fredericksburg, Va. – The St. Mary’s College of Maryland men’s tennis team claimed 11 games between singles and doubles action from nationally-ranked University of Mary Washington Saturday afternoon in Capital Athletic Conference action. The No. 12 Eagles (17-3, 7-0 CAC), however, notched a 9-0 win over St. Mary’s (5-8, 2-4 CAC) to finish conference play with a perfect record.
St. Mary’s 0, Mary Washington 9

How It Happened
Doubles:
- Sophomores Jon Gorel (Jessup, Md./Hammond) and Ethan Garren(Arnold, Md./Broadneck) took three games from UMW’s regionally-ranked top duo, Ryland Byrd and Michael Fleming, before falling 8-3. The UMW duo is ranked fourth in the Atlantic South region.
Singles:
- Gorel claimed five games in a 6-1, 6-4 loss to Matt Miles, who is regionally-ranked ninth, at No. 1 singles.
- Garren faced Patrick Hughes, who is ranked 15th in the region, at No. 2 singles, dropping a 6-1, 6-2 decision.
- Senior captain Kyle Van Winter (Scaggsville, Md./Good Counsel) was the only other Seahawk to win a game today as Van Winter lost 6-0, 6-1 at No. 5 singles to Derek Hagino.
